Whilst Ive been waiting eagerly for the hot fix to come out I thought Id have a bit of an experiment on ai teams performance, specifically to the top 4 teams in the Premier League and Ive had some rather strange results... Below are the finishing top 4 teams taken all from the 2010/11 season played 3 times (I have been playing holiday mode with full detail on the matches). I have included the cup winners as well for the sake of it. See what you think.

Season One:

1st. Arsenal, 2nd Liverpool, 3rd. Stoke, 4th. Tottenham FA Cup = Everton, League Cup = Everton

Season Two:

1st. Man u, 2nd. Bolton, 3rd. Liverpool, 4th. Chelsea FA Cup = Fulham, League Cup = Bristol City

Season Three:

1st. Liverpool, 2nd. Tottenham, 3rd. Arsenal, 4th. Man City FA Cup = Arsenal League Cup = Middlesbrough

Ive done this on several other occasions and got similar results. It seems that the bigger sides (especially Chelsea) are underachieving quite a bit and takes quite a lot of realism out of the game for me.
